Поделиться через


Threads - List Threads

Возвращает список созданных ранее потоков.

GET {endpoint}/threads?api-version=v1
GET {endpoint}/threads?api-version=v1&limit={limit}&order={order}&after={after}&before={before}

Параметры URI

Имя В Обязательно Тип Описание
endpoint
path True

string (uri)

Конечная точка проекта в виде: https://.services.ai.azure.com/api/projects/

api-version
query True

string

minLength: 1

Версия API, используемая для данной операции.

after
query

string

Курсор для использования в разбиении на страницы. После этого является идентификатором объекта, который определяет место в списке. Например, если вы делаете запрос списка и получаете 100 объектов, заканчивая obj_foo, последующий вызов может включать after=obj_foo, чтобы получить следующую страницу списка.

before
query

string

Курсор для использования в разбиении на страницы. прежде чем является идентификатором объекта, который определяет место в списке. Например, если вы делаете запрос списка и получаете 100 объектов, заканчивая obj_foo, последующий вызов может включать до=obj_foo, чтобы получить предыдущую страницу списка.

limit
query

integer (int32)

Ограничение количества возвращаемых объектов. Ограничение может быть от 1 до 100, а значение по умолчанию — 20.

order
query

ListSortOrder

Сортировка по created_at метке времени объектов. asc для возрастания порядка и desc для убывающего порядка.

Ответы

Имя Тип Описание
200 OK

Запрашиваемый список потоков.

Other Status Codes

AgentV1Error

Непредвиденное сообщение об ошибке.

Безопасность

OAuth2Auth

Тип: oauth2
Flow: implicit
URL-адрес авторизации: https://login.microsoftonline.com/common/oauth2/v2.0/authorize

Области

Имя Описание
https://ai.azure.com/.default

Примеры

Threads_ListThreads_MaximumSet
Threads_ListThreads_MinimumSet

Threads_ListThreads_MaximumSet

Образец запроса

GET {endpoint}/threads?api-version=v1&limit=16&order=asc&after=mwffzlurbubmwolotcxl&before=ytakgvhqriykuirndnrqcuekophged

Пример ответа

{
  "data": [
    {
      "id": "qkbkoichtwadx",
      "object": "thread",
      "created_at": 18,
      "tool_resources": {
        "code_interpreter": {
          "file_ids": [
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v",
            "lrxbwhmsewnzmfushighvgbv"
          ],
          "data_sources": [
            {
              "uri": "jtookuzhwojyylbips",
              "type": "uri_asset"
            },
            {
              "uri": "jtookuzhwojyylbips",
              "type": "uri_asset"
            },
            {
              "uri": "jtookuzhwojyylbips",
              "type": "uri_asset"
            },
            {
              "uri": "jtookuzhwojyylbips",
              "type": "uri_asset"
            },
            {
              "uri": "jtookuzhwojyylbips",
              "type": "uri_asset"
            },
            {
              "uri": "jtookuzhwojyylbips",
              "type": "uri_asset"
            },
            {
              "uri": "jtookuzhwojyylbips",
              "type": "uri_asset"
            },
            {
              "uri": "jtookuzhwojyylbips",
              "type": "uri_asset"
            },
            {
              "uri": "jtookuzhwojyylbips",
              "type": "uri_asset"
            },
            {
              "uri": "jtookuzhwojyylbips",
              "type": "uri_asset"
            },
            {
              "uri": "jtookuzhwojyylbips",
              "type": "uri_asset"
            }
          ]
        },
        "file_search": {
          "vector_store_ids": [
            "ezeljyggzgyvliaif"
          ],
          "vector_stores": [
            {
              "name": "jtpzxxafdiapssaxxruzkitbpmdovh",
              "configuration": {
                "data_sources": [
                  {
                    "uri": "jtookuzhwojyylbips",
                    "type": "uri_asset"
                  }
                ]
              }
            }
          ]
        },
        "azure_ai_search": {
          "indexes": [
            {
              "index_connection_id": "nfeoncaophxqnhmsewmckkwbyv",
              "index_name": "nidrehbyzdpvelcltqqloq",
              "query_type": "simple",
              "top_k": 4,
              "filter": "hrfico",
              "index_asset_id": "wybmymisqviehjpplxbrjtmaxejq"
            }
          ]
        }
      },
      "metadata": {
        "key3754": "jnoo"
      }
    }
  ],
  "last_id": "bgzaixxumgscynjpbyeyymj",
  "has_more": true
}

Threads_ListThreads_MinimumSet

Образец запроса

GET {endpoint}/threads?api-version=v1

Пример ответа

{
  "data": [
    {
      "id": "qkbkoichtwadx",
      "object": "thread",
      "created_at": 18,
      "tool_resources": {},
      "metadata": {}
    }
  ],
  "has_more": true
}

Определения

Имя Описание
AgentErrorDetail

Описывает сведения об ошибках, возвращаемые API агентов.

AgentV1Error

Полезная нагрузка ошибки, возвращенная API агентов.

ListSortOrder

Доступные варианты сортировки при запросе списка объектов ответа.

AgentErrorDetail

Описывает сведения об ошибках, возвращаемые API агентов.

Имя Тип Описание
code

string

Машиночитаемый код ошибки.

message

string

Удобочитаемое описание ошибки.

param

string

Имя параметра, вызвавшего ошибку, если применимо.

type

string

Идентификатор типа ошибки (например, invalid_request_error).

AgentV1Error

Полезная нагрузка ошибки, возвращенная API агентов.

Имя Тип Описание
error

AgentErrorDetail

Представляет собой ошибку.

ListSortOrder

Доступные варианты сортировки при запросе списка объектов ответа.

Значение Описание
asc

Задает порядок сортировки по возрастанию.

desc

Задает порядок сортировки по убыванию.